
在区块链世界,签名既是权力的凭证,也是信任的阀门。TPWallet作为常见的移动/浏览器钱包,其签名确认流程既承载着用户对资产控制的最后一道防线,也反映了钱包在用户体验与安全之间的设计取舍。本文从实操出发,深入解析如何在TPWallet中确认签名,并把这项技能放入数字身份、便捷与灵活支付、冷钱包实践、智能资产配置与信息化创新的大背景中,给出系统化的风险识别与技术演进洞见。
一、签名确认的本质与风险点
签名本质上是用户对一笔操作的授权,无论是转账、授权代币额度、调用合约方法,还是以Typed Data签名声明身份。风险来自两端:一是签名的“含义”不透明——页面只显示抽象信息而非真实参数;二是签名的“对象”不可辨——用户难以确认签名目标是否为恶意合约或钓鱼dApp。常见攻击包括伪造交易字段让用户以为是简单转账却触发授权,以及以签名绑定不利条款的离线声明。
二、在TPWallet中逐项确认签名的实操步骤(检查清单)
1) 核验来源与域名:确认是在可信dApp或通过正规WalletConnect连接,注意域名拼写与证书提示。 2) 逐字阅读签名摘要:不要只看金额或“签名授权”这类模糊说明,展开查看原文/JSON。 3) 检查接收地址与合约:确认to地址是熟悉的钱包或受信合约,必要时在区块浏览器检索合约源码/验证信息。 4) 分析调用方法与参数:转账、approve、setApprovalForAll、swap等含义不同;注意是否存在无限期、大额度授权。 5) 留意链ID与nonce:防止重放攻击或跨链误操作。 6) 注意Gas与付费方:是否为用户直接支付Gas,或采用meta-transaction由relayer付费。 7) 若是Typed Data(EIP-712),理解域结构与签名字段,EIP-712可以把签名语义化,便于审阅;若看不到结构要谨慎。 8) 使用冷钱包确认:若有硬件签名设备,优先在设备上核对显示的to/amount/方法名并在设备按键确认。 9) 对可疑请求拒签并通过官方渠道核实,如dApp官方渠道或社群公告。 10) 定期撤销不必要的授权,使用revoke工具审查approve列表。
三、数字身份技术如何增强签名确认

数字身份(DID、Verifiable Credentials)把“谁在签名”与“签的是什么意思”用可验证的凭证表达。将签名与身份证书绑定后,dApp可以请求带有约束的签名(例如仅允许某类操作),而钱包则能在UI中以可理解的权限语义展示签名目的,减小误签概率。此外,基于凭证的选择性披露可避免将过多敏感信息放入签名内容,从而提高隐私与安全。
四、便捷支付与灵活支付的技术动向
为降低用户体验门槛,业界发展出meta-transaction、gasless支付、账户抽象(ERC-4337)等方案:relayer替用户支付Gas,或通过“社交回收/委托签名”实现免私钥操作。但便捷不可等于放松审查,签名确认仍需明确授权范围。灵活支付方向还包括可编程付款(定期、条件触发)、支付渠道与多签阈值策略,结合智能合约钱包实现更细粒度的权限管理与风险隔离。
五、冷钱包在签名确认中的角色
冷钱包提供物理隔离的签名环境,是对抗网络钓鱼与恶意软件的有效手段。理想流程是:在连网设备上构造交易/签名请求,离线设备显示全部关键字段并签名,签名结果通过二维码或USB传回并广播。硬件设备的显示与按键确认是防篡改的核心,但也需注意固件来源与供应链安全。未来的硬件将更好地支持EIP-712和复杂Typed Data的本地可视化,降低用户理解成本。
六、智能资产配置与签名治理的结合
智能资产配置依赖自动化策略(如再平衡、收益聚合器、保险与杠杆),这些策略常由合约或策略管理器触发。将签名治理嵌入策略链路,可以用临时授权、时间锁、多签或基于阈值的MPC(多方计算)签名来控制策略执行权限,从而在保持自动化收益的同时降低单点出错风险。组合化的权限模型和审计日志是资产管理可信度的关键。
七、信息化创新方向与未来展望
为提升签名确认的可理解性与自动化,未来方向包括:统一的签名语义标准(EIP-712普及化与更友好的本地可视化)、零知识技术用于证明签名意图而不泄露细节、基于声誉与信誉的权限适配、以及更智能的风险提醒(结合链上行为模型与社交信号)。此外,MPC+TEE(可信执行环境)的混合方案将改善冷热钱包在体验与安全间的权衡。
结语:签名既是用户主权的最后一环,也是技术与体验竞争的前沿。在TPWallet这样的终端,用户的“点击确认”不应只是信任的赌注,而应是建立在可视化信息、标准化语义与多层防护之上的理性选择。掌握签名核验的实操清单,结合数字身份与冷钱包等技术,可以把数字资产的安全和便捷并行推进。未来的挑战是将复杂的安全语义以更直观、可审计的方式交给用户,让每一次签名既高效又可信。